Relax in the scenic Chester County countryside at The Farmhouse Retreat Center, a restored 300+ year old mill (the old mill wheel is still available for viewing), the perfect place to recharge and explore the unique gardens and historic sites nearby. Winterthur, Nemours, Mt. Cuba Center and The Laurels are other natural wonders close by, along with the Brandywine Museum, historic Chadds Ford and the Brandywine Battlefield. The borough of Kennett Square is down the road, 1.5 miles, with art galleries, boutiques, gift shops, a brand new library with a special floor just for kids, and restaurants of every cuisine to enjoy. Runners love the 5K and 10K Kennett Run in May, September brings the annual Mushroom Festival, October has the October Brewfest. The magic of the holiday season is in magnificent display at Longwood Gardens and Winterthur.
